Fleet Preventive Maintenance: Building a More Reliable Fleet

Managing a fleet requires more than keeping vehicles operational. Fleet managers need to control maintenance costs, reduce downtime, improve vehicle safety, and ensure every vehicle is ready when needed. This is why Fleet Preventive Maintenance plays an important role in modern fleet operations.

Fleet Preventive Maintenance involves performing inspections, servicing, and repairs before a vehicle develops a serious problem. Instead of waiting for a breakdown, fleet managers can schedule maintenance based on mileage, engine hours, time intervals, manufacturer recommendations, and vehicle usage. This proactive approach helps organizations identify potential issues early and keep vehicles operating reliably.

Why Fleet Preventive Maintenance Matters

Unexpected breakdowns can quickly affect fleet productivity. A single vehicle failure may result in missed deliveries, delayed services, driver downtime, emergency repair expenses, and customer dissatisfaction. Preventive maintenance helps reduce these risks by addressing vehicle requirements before they become major failures.

Regular inspections can cover essential components such as brakes, tires, engine oil, batteries, suspension, steering, cooling systems, filters, belts, and electrical components. When these systems are monitored consistently, fleet managers have better visibility into vehicle condition and can schedule repairs at a convenient time.

Another important benefit is cost control. Emergency repairs are often more expensive because they may require urgent parts, towing, specialist technicians, or extended vehicle downtime. Planned maintenance makes expenses more predictable and allows businesses to budget for regular servicing.

The Role of Fleet Predictive Maintenance

While preventive maintenance is based largely on planned schedules and known service requirements, fleet predictive maintenance takes a more data-driven approach. It uses information from vehicle diagnostics, telematics, mileage, operating patterns, historical maintenance records, and other data sources to identify signs of potential problems.

For example, instead of servicing every vehicle at exactly the same interval, predictive maintenance can help identify vehicles showing unusual performance or signs of component deterioration. Fleet managers can then prioritize those vehicles for inspection or service.

This approach can make maintenance more targeted and efficient, particularly for large fleets where manually monitoring every vehicle can become difficult.

Creating an Effective Maintenance Strategy

An effective maintenance strategy should begin with accurate vehicle records. Fleet managers should track each vehicle’s mileage, engine hours, service history, repair records, and upcoming maintenance requirements.

A consistent inspection process should also be established. Drivers and maintenance teams should know which components need to be checked and how defects should be reported.

Technology can further improve the process by providing automated maintenance reminders, digital service histories, work-order management, and vehicle condition information. These capabilities reduce dependence on spreadsheets and manual tracking.

Fleet managers should also monitor key performance indicators such as vehicle downtime, maintenance costs, breakdown frequency, preventive maintenance completion rates, and vehicle availability. These metrics can show whether the maintenance strategy is delivering measurable operational improvements.
